1. Product Overview
Hot dipped galvanized steel coil is used in applications where both corrosion protection and reliable forming performance are required. For buyers focusing on durable service life, a higher zinc coating such as Z275 is commonly selected because it provides a thicker protective layer against moisture, oxidation, and general atmospheric exposure.
Bright surface and slit edge are often specified for downstream fabrication where appearance, edge condition, and dimensional control matter. In practical use, this combination is suitable for construction panels, machinery parts, enclosures, and general industrial sheet processing.

8. FAQ
Q1: Why is Z275 commonly selected for durable use?
Because higher coating mass provides stronger corrosion protection and usually supports longer service life in exposed environments.
Q2: What is the difference between slit edge and mill edge?
Slit edge is produced after width cutting and is commonly used where controlled strip width is required, while mill edge keeps the original rolled edge.
Q3: Is bright surface the same as polished surface?
No. Bright surface refers to a cleaner, more uniform galvanized appearance, but it is not a polished decorative finish.
Q4: Can this coil be processed into narrow strips or sheets?
Yes, it can be slit into strips or cut to length into sheets depending on downstream requirements.
Q5: Is this material suitable for forming and fabrication?
Yes, elongation of 12–25% supports bending, profiling, and general fabrication processes.
